What Makes Our Capstone Projects Unique?
Hands-On Innovation with a Purpose
Our capstone projects are not just academic exercises—they are carefully structured 14-week experiences that allow students to combine research, program development, and customized solutions for community needs. Each student produces three deliverables:- A conference presentation based on their research.
- A program development project to address a specific need.
- A deliverable tailored to their site’s unique requirements.
From the very first week, students hit the ground running, completing an Institutional Review Board (IRB) submission, ensuring their projects meet the highest ethical and research standards. By week seven, they’re presenting significant progress on all three deliverables. This rigorous timeline ensures students stay engaged, focused, and ready to make a meaningful contribution.

Real Stories, Real Impact
Empowering Local Communities: One of our students collaborated with a nonprofit serving immigrant farmers, developing tailored ergonomic solutions to prevent injuries in agricultural work. This project not only improved lives but also showcased how occupational therapy can intersect with unique industries.
Advancing Tech in OT: Another student worked with a tech company to develop a virtual reality program for stroke rehabilitation, combining cutting-edge technology with evidence-based practice to create a tool that improves patient outcomes.
